"start awake" is a grammatically correct and usable phrase in written English.
It is often used to describe the sudden arousal from sleep or a dream. It can also be used metaphorically to describe a sudden realization or awakening to a situation. Example: "The loud noise outside made me start awake from my peaceful slumber."
